一同聊聊 SwiftUI 规划协定
假设咱们停上去思索每一种或许的状况,编写规划容器或许会让咱们步履维艰。有的视图经常使用尽或许多的空间,有的视图会尽量顺应,还有的将会经常使用的更少,等等。当然还有规划优先级,当多个视图须要竞争同一个空间会变得愈加困难。但是,这项义务或许并不像看起来艰难。咱们或许会经常使用自己的规划,并且或许会提早知道咱们的容器会有什么类型的视图。例如,假设你计划只用方形图片或许文本视图来经常使用自己的容器,或许你知道你的容器会有详细尺寸,或许你确定你一切的视图都领有一样的优先级,等等。这些消息都可以大大的简化义务。即使你不能有这种奢望来做这种假定,它也或许是开局编码的好中央,让你的规划在一些状况下上班,而后开局为更复杂的状况参与代码。